ANGELICA | id:23992 | Angelica archangelica | Certified Organic by Ecocert Canada | Biennial/self-seeds | Open Pollinated | Heirloom

Roots and leaves are traditionally used for coughs, congestion, digestion, rheumatism, and urinary support. Famous for candied stems for cake decorating—steam stems like asparagus; naturally sweet with a licorice flavor, and pairs well with rhubarb. Dried leaves make tea or seasoning, and it’s a key flavor in liqueurs like Benedictine and Chartreuse, plus gin and vermouth. Sow in fall, overwinter seedlings in a cold frame, then transplant in spring to a permanent spot (avoid moving mature plants). Thrives in rich soil with dry shade; becomes lush and blooms in year 2–3. Spacing: 12″ (30 cm).

Companion plants: Epidemiums, Ferns, Hellebores, Lily-Of-The-Valley, Sweet Woodruff. 
Far from: Dill.
Planting tip: Seed stratification is required for 3 weeks. Sow indoors 6-8 weeks before last frost.||Can direct sow when all danger of frost has passed.
Harvesting tip: Handle gently as leaves bruise easily or turn black. Harvest mid to late afternoon, after morning dew has dried off for strongest oil content.
Storage tip:  Store in plastic bag for up to 3-4 days

Seed depth:1/4″ Direct, Plant spacing:12-24”, Row spacing:18-36”, Sun Level:3, Watering Level:3, Germination:21-28 d/j, 15-18°C Optimally:1523°C, Maturity:3-4 y/a, Height: 3-5′, Width: 1.5-2′, Edible leaf, Edible flower, Attracts pollinators
